在当今的Web开发领域,jQuery已经成为了前端开发者的必备技能之一。它简化了HTML文档遍历、事件处理、动画和AJAX操作,极大地提高了开发效率。如果你是一名前端开发者,或者对前端开发感兴趣,那么学会jQuery将是一个非常有价值的能力。本文将为你提供一个从新手到高手的jQuery学习路径,并附上实战教程的免费下载方式。
第一章:jQuery入门
1.1 什么是jQuery?
jQuery是一个快速、小型且功能丰富的JavaScript库。它使得JavaScript编程更加简单,通过选择器、事件处理、动画和AJAX等技术,让开发者能够轻松地实现各种Web效果。
1.2 为什么学习jQuery?
- 简化JavaScript编程,提高开发效率。
- 支持跨浏览器兼容性,减少浏览器兼容性问题。
- 提供丰富的插件和工具,方便开发者实现各种功能。
1.3 jQuery的安装和配置
你可以从jQuery官网(https://jquery.com/)下载jQuery库。下载完成后,将其引入到你的HTML页面中即可使用。
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
第二章:jQuery基础语法
2.1 选择器
jQuery提供了一系列选择器,用于选取HTML元素。以下是一些常用的选择器:
- 元素选择器:
$("element"),例如:$("p")选取所有<p>元素。 - 类选择器:
$(".class"),例如:$(".red")选取所有具有red类的元素。 - ID选择器:
$("#id"),例如:$("#myId")选取具有myId的元素。
2.2 事件处理
jQuery提供了丰富的事件处理方法,例如:
click():处理鼠标点击事件。hover():处理鼠标悬停事件。change():处理表单元素内容变化事件。
2.3 动画
jQuery提供了强大的动画功能,例如:
animate():执行动画效果。fadeIn()、fadeOut():实现淡入淡出效果。slideToggle():实现滑动效果。
第三章:jQuery高级技巧
3.1 插件开发
jQuery插件是扩展jQuery功能的一种方式。你可以通过编写插件来扩展jQuery的功能。
3.2 AJAX
jQuery提供了强大的AJAX功能,可以方便地实现异步数据交互。
$.ajax({
url: "example.com/data",
type: "GET",
success: function(data) {
// 处理响应数据
}
});
3.3 模板和数据处理
jQuery提供了模板和数据处理功能,可以方便地实现数据绑定和渲染。
第四章:实战教程免费下载
为了帮助你更好地学习jQuery,我们为你准备了一份实战教程,涵盖jQuery的入门、进阶和实战应用。以下是教程的下载链接:
这份教程包含以下内容:
- jQuery基础语法
- jQuery实战案例
- jQuery插件开发
- jQuery与AJAX
- jQuery与前端框架
希望这份教程能够帮助你从新手成长为jQuery高手。祝你在前端开发的道路上越走越远!
